BerlinWhile the doorbell rings at schools in Berlin this morning for the first court break, a small crowd of people is gathering in front of the Lichtenberg Town Hall. In the end there will be 80 interested parties who have registered for a special trip that starts here. The district of Lichtenberg is taking creative ways to get staff for its currently more than 50 schools and has invited teachers, educators, career changers and interested parties to an advertising trip to ten schools in the district.
